The Norwegian Appeal Board for Health Personnel is the highest administrative appeal board that handles appeals from health personnel. It handles decisions regarding administrative sanctions handed down by the Norwegian Board of Health Supervision, for instance warnings or withdrawing of authorisations. The board is also the appeals body for certain decisions made by the Norwegian Medicines Agency pursuant to the Pharmacies Act (the Norwegian Pharmacy Appeals Board).
